Nestled in the picturesque coastal town of Rockport, Massachusetts, the Paper House is a one-of-a-kind historical museum that captivates visitors with its extraordinary architecture and intriguing history. This unique attraction, built entirely from newspaper, showcases the creativity and ingenuity of its creator, making it a must-visit for tourists seeking an unconventional experience.

Getting There
-
Car
If you are traveling by car, start from downtown Rockport. Head east on Main St toward Broadway. Continue on Main St for about 0.5 miles. After passing through a residential area, turn right onto Pigeon Hill St. Continue straight for about 0.3 miles, and you will find Paper House on your left at 52 Pigeon Hill St, Rockport, MA 01966. There is parking available near the site.
-
Public Transportation
To reach Paper House via public transportation, take the MBTA commuter rail to Rockport Station. From the station, you can either take a taxi (which may cost around $10-$15) or use a rideshare service like Uber or Lyft to reach Paper House. Alternatively, you can walk from the station, which is about a 1-mile walk. Head south on Broadway, then turn left onto Main St, and follow the directions above to Pigeon Hill St.
